Ornamental iron is the defining fence material in Rancho Mirage - it matches the architectural character of the city's resort-style homes and is commonly pre-approved by HOAs in communities like Mission Hills and The Springs. Powder-coated iron holds up through 110-degree summers without the UV degradation that plagues lighter materials, and the visual weight of a properly designed iron fence adds to property value in this market. For pool enclosures and yard perimeters where corrosion resistance matters, aluminum is the right material in Rancho Mirage. It will not rust from pool chlorine mist or monsoon moisture, it meets California pool barrier code at the correct installed height, and it is lighter to handle than iron in summer heat. Rancho Mirage homes with pools - which is nearly all single-family homes here - typically use aluminum for the pool barrier and ornamental iron for the street-facing perimeter.
Rancho Mirage has one of the highest rates of private pool ownership in California, and California law requires compliant barriers around residential pools. We install pool fences that meet California Building Code Section R326 - including self-closing, self-latching gate hardware - for homes throughout the city. If you are selling or refinancing a Rancho Mirage property, a compliant pool enclosure is often required before closing.
Rancho Mirage homeowners who want to enclose an outdoor living space without a view of the street or neighboring lots typically use solid vinyl or composite privacy panels. These materials hold their color through the Coachella Valley heat, do not require sealing, and are available in profiles that meet most HOA appearance standards. Privacy fencing around patios and outdoor kitchens is common in Rancho Mirage, where outdoor living is a year-round activity.
Many Rancho Mirage properties - particularly those on larger lots or corner parcels - have driveway gates that benefit from motorized operators. We install swing and slide gate operators with remote, keypad, and intercom access for residential driveways throughout the city. Motor hardware is specified for the Coachella Valley temperature range, where a standard residential-grade operator will fail quickly under sustained heat.
Seasonal residents returning to Rancho Mirage in the fall sometimes find gate hardware that has loosened from summer heat expansion, post anchors that have shifted in sandy soil, or panels that have racked during monsoon wind events. We assess the full fence condition on arrival and give a clear picture of what needs repair now and what can wait - so you are not replacing sections that still have years of useful life.
Rancho Mirage is a city where the fence is part of the property presentation - not an afterthought. Gated communities like Mission Hills, The Springs, and Tamarisk have architectural review committees that evaluate every exterior change, and a fence that does not match the community standard in materials, color, or height profile will get rejected. The permitting process runs through the City of Rancho Mirage separately from neighboring Cathedral City and Palm Desert, and the HOA approval layer adds an additional step that contractors unfamiliar with this market routinely underestimate. The result is projects that stall in the approval phase when documentation is incomplete or material specifications do not match what the HOA has on file as approved.
The climate adds its own demands. Summer temperatures in Rancho Mirage regularly exceed 110 degrees Fahrenheit, and the sandy Coachella Valley soil shifts during the late-summer monsoon season when brief but intense rains saturate the ground. Posts that are not set to adequate depth in that soil will rock within a season or two. Gate hardware not rated for the temperature range will fail prematurely. A large share of Rancho Mirage's homes were built in the 1970s and 1980s, which means original fencing on those properties is now 40-plus years old and showing the effects of decades of desert heat, UV exposure, and thermal cycling. If your home is in that era of construction, there is a good chance a fence inspection will reveal more wear than the surface suggests.

Rancho Mirage is a small city of roughly 18,000 residents in the heart of the Coachella Valley, situated about 15 miles east of Palm Springs along Highway 111. The city has long been associated with resort living, celebrity homes, and golf communities, and that character is visible in its housing stock - predominantly single-story ranch and desert contemporary homes on well-maintained lots, most of them built between the 1970s and the 1990s. Gated developments like Mission Hills Country Club and The Springs are among the best-known addresses in the Coachella Valley, with hundreds of condos and single-family homes managed under HOA governance.
A notable share of Rancho Mirage homeowners are seasonal residents - people who live here in the fall and winter and leave during the brutal summer heat. This pattern shapes how home service work gets scheduled here, and it is something we account for in project planning.
